Bird of paradise plants were introduced into California in 1853 by Colonel Warren, editor of the California Farmer magazine, and were available for sale in Montecito, a wealthy enclave of Santa Barbara in the 1870s.. 4. These plants became such emblems of southern California that in 1952 they were named the official flower of the city of Los Angeles by Mayor Fletcher Bowron. Vipersniper / Getty Images Plants of the Caesalpinia genus that carry the common name "bird of paradise" are much different than the Strelitzia species.Caesalpinia pulcherrima, sometimes known as "red bird of paradise," "pride of Barbados," or "peacock flower," is a fast-growing, broad-leaved evergreen shrub native to arid regions.It blooms repeatedly with red-orange flowers.
